Abstract

The contribution addresses the implementation of new progressive technologies in the field of electric traction in order to reduce feedback influence on the power network. First of all, it concerns Flexible Alternating Current energy Transmission Systems (FACTS), which, on the one hand, limit negative influence of the electric traction; on the other hand, they improve parameters of the power network by an electronic method. Taking their effects into account, the Power Active Filters (PAF) muddle through at most, because they allow compensation of fundamental harmonics, higher harmonics and also help to adapt energetic systems to Electromagnetic Compatibility (EMC) standards. Using the mentioned progressive technologies it is possible to achieve a higher value of effectiveness of electric energy transmission to a traction network.
